Funchal is the capital city of the autonomous region of Madeira on the island of Madeira. The city is located to the south between the cities of Santa Cruz and Camara de Lobos. It is actually named for the fennel plant which grows liberally on the island. The city was most significant as a shipping center between the 15th and 17th centuries. Today it has a population of over 100,000 people and is, arguably, one of the most picturesque cities in Portugal. It's appeal as a tourist destination has made it the leading Portuguese port for cruise line dockings.
Bonn was the capital of the Federal Republic of Germany (previously, West Germany) and it has a population of about 315,000 people. It sits on the Rhine River just twenty kilometers away from Cologne. Many people travel to Bonn for conferences and business, but Bonn also has a lot of cultural and historical sights to offer visitors. The city is also famous as the birth place of Ludwig van Beethoven. There's a strong student culture in the city as well, and it actually shares many characteristics with Italian cities because of its many cafes and restaurants which line the streets. Outdoor beer gardens are popular and Bonn is a particular good summer destination when the weather is pleasant and you can enjoy the outdoor setting. The city's location also makes it a great base for day trips to Cologne, Dusseldorf, and the Rhine and Eifel regions.

The average daily cost (per person) in Funchal is €93, while the average daily cost in Bonn is €154.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. In July, Funchal is generally a little warmer than Bonn. Daily temperatures in Funchal average around 22°C (72°F), and Bonn fluctuates around 19°C (66°F).
The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Funchal. Funchal usually receives more sunshine than Bonn during summer. Funchal gets 227 hours of sunny skies, while Bonn receives 191 hours of full sun in the summer.
In July, Funchal usually receives less rain than Bonn. Funchal gets 10 mm (0.4 in) of rain, while Bonn receives 78 mm (3.1 in) of rain each month for the summer.

Funchal is much warmer than Bonn in the autumn. The daily temperature in Funchal averages around 21°C (70°F) in October, and Bonn fluctuates around 12°C (53°F).
In the autumn, Funchal often gets more sunshine than Bonn. Funchal gets 183 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Bonn receives 109 hours of full sun.
It rains a lot this time of the year in Funchal. Funchal usually gets more rain in October than Bonn. Funchal gets 100 mm (3.9 in) of rain, while Bonn receives 47 mm (1.9 in) of rain this time of the year.

Bonn can get quite cold in the winter. In the winter, Funchal is much warmer than Bonn. Typically, the winter temperatures in Funchal in January average around 16°C (61°F), and Bonn averages at about 3°C (37°F).
Funchal usually receives more sunshine than Bonn during winter. Funchal gets 141 hours of sunny skies, while Bonn receives 45 hours of full sun in the winter.
Funchal gets a good bit of rain this time of year. In January, Funchal usually receives more rain than Bonn. Funchal gets 110 mm (4.3 in) of rain, while Bonn receives 49 mm (1.9 in) of rain each month for the winter.

In April, Funchal is generally much warmer than Bonn. Daily temperatures in Funchal average around 17°C (63°F), and Bonn fluctuates around 10°C (50°F).
In the spring, Funchal often gets more sunshine than Bonn. Funchal gets 182 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Bonn receives 145 hours of full sun.
Funchal usually gets more rain in April than Bonn. Funchal gets 70 mm (2.8 in) of rain, while Bonn receives 48 mm (1.9 in) of rain this time of the year.
Funchal | Bonn | |||
---|---|---|---|---|
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| |
Jan | 16°C (61°F) | 110 mm (4.3 in) | 3°C (37°F) | 49 mm (1.9 in) |
Feb | 16°C (61°F) | 80 mm (3.1 in) | 4°C (39°F) | 36 mm (1.4 in) |
Mar | 16°C (61°F) | 60 mm (2.4 in) | 7°C (44°F) | 47 mm (1.8 in) |
Apr | 17°C (63°F) | 70 mm (2.8 in) | 10°C (50°F) | 48 mm (1.9 in) |
May | 19°C (66°F) | 20 mm (0.8 in) | 14°C (58°F) | 67 mm (2.6 in) |
Jun | 21°C (70°F) | 10 mm (0.4 in) | 17°C (63°F) | 73 mm (2.9 in) |
Jul | 22°C (72°F) | 10 mm (0.4 in) | 19°C (66°F) | 78 mm (3.1 in) |
Aug | 23°C (73°F) | 10 mm (0.4 in) | 19°C (66°F) | 68 mm (2.7 in) |
Sep | 23°C (73°F) | 40 mm (1.6 in) | 16°C (61°F) | 58 mm (2.3 in) |
Oct | 21°C (70°F) | 100 mm (3.9 in) | 12°C (53°F) | 47 mm (1.9 in) |
Nov | 19°C (66°F) | 100 mm (3.9 in) | 7°C (44°F) | 56 mm (2.2 in) |
Dec | 18°C (64°F) | 90 mm (3.5 in) | 4°C (39°F) | 53 mm (2.1 in) |
